Sweden to win or draw v Mexico –

Sweden are hard to beat, as they were so close to proving before Toni Kroos’ 95th-minute free-kick on Saturday.

Janne Andersson’s side had kept three consecutive clean sheets before their match with the world champions, which was also just their fourth defeat in 14 competitive outings.

Mexico are still vulnerable to a group-stage exit if they lose by more than one goal, so will be reluctant to open up the game too much, particularly if they fall behind. A point would guarantee top spot in Group F.

Germany (-1) to beat South Korea –

It’s hard to know whether Germany’s dramatic victory over Sweden was unconvincing or represents the turning of a corner, but I’m inclined to go for the latter.

Toni Kroos’ brilliant free-kick epitomised the Germans’ unceasing winning mentality, while Joachim Low did appear to find a successful formula in the second half.

They are now a fair bet to win at least one group stage match by more than one goal for the sixth consecutive World Cup.

South Korea have just one long-range strike from Son Heung-Min to show for their attacking efforts, after failing to register a shot on target in their opener against Sweden.

Brazil to beat Serbia –

Brazil played well in the second half against Costa Rica on Friday, eventually breaking through in injury-time to go top of Group E.

So while defeat here would likely see them eliminated, Tite’s side – inspired by Philippe Coutinho, who is playing magnificently – should continue that form and claim their 19th win in 24 matches.

Serbia know that a win will take them through, but the fact they were deservedly beaten by Switzerland on Friday is a concern ahead of a game against superior opposition.

Switzerland to beat Costa Rica –

Switzerland are in the useful habit of virtually never losing, having avoided defeat in 90 minutes in all but one of their last 24 matches.

And, after Granit Xhaka and Xherdan Shaqiri avoided FIFA bans for their ‘Albanian Eagle’ goal celebration against Serbia, they should continue that run and secure the three points that will guarantee qualification.

Costa Rica have lost four consecutive matches, including defeat to nil in both Group E matches so far.
